Output 33f99a9b9957d2a78f1d643d96c4efaf0d2d1a7d167e1e1760c86989bb8e6cec:1

value
11910202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d395872f4a692c5edd3861fd3c849c6324929df OP_EQUAL
address
3JwYLEbPrPDFx14QL6kFSbyzmSMgHcbXm4
transaction
33f99a9b9957d2a78f1d643d96c4efaf0d2d1a7d167e1e1760c86989bb8e6cec
spent
true